How to read these benchmarks
Treat these Google Display Network figures as a diagnostic range, not a goal. a result inside the range usually means the constraint is elsewhere - offer, landing experience, or measurement - while a result well outside it points straight at targeting, creative, or bid strategy. Compare like with like - same funnel stage, same objective, same season - because a top-of-funnel number judged against a bottom-of-funnel benchmark will always mislead.
